Cyclone Fence Installation in Pearland, TX
Cyclone fence installation services provide a durable and affordable option for property owners looking to enclose or define their outdoor spaces. These fences are typically made from galvanized steel, offering strength and resistance to weathering, making them suitable for a variety of projects such as securing yards, creating privacy barriers, or marking property boundaries. Homeowners often request this service when they want a low-maintenance fencing solution that can withstand the elements and provide long-lasting security.
Before requesting cyclone fence installation, property owners should consider the specific dimensions and layout of the area to be fenced, as well as any local regulations or property restrictions. It’s also helpful to determine the desired height and gauge of the fencing, depending on whether the goal is security, privacy, or boundary marking. Understanding these details can help ensure the installation aligns with property needs and complies with local codes.

Cyclone Fence Installation Questions
What are the common types of cyclone fences available? Common options include chain-link, vinyl-coated, and galvanized fences, suitable for various security and privacy needs.
How long does cyclone fence installation typically take? Installation duration depends on the size of the property and fence complexity, but it generally ranges from a few days to a week.
What factors influence the choice of cyclone fencing? Property size, purpose (security, privacy, containment), and environmental conditions are key factors in selecting the right fencing type.
Are there any permits required for cyclone fence installation? Permit requirements vary by location; it’s advisable to check local regulations before beginning installation.
